The scam advisory - a free resource from Kahunalife™ Major Scam Alert Fake Law Firm & Debt Collection Scam There is a serious Fake Law-Firm Scam in the US right now. Some group of scumbags were trying to put this one over on me, unaware that I write consumer articles on fraud.  The scam basically goes like this:  You get a call from a (spoofed) local phone number with a live rep or recorded message about a debt collection lawsuit. They explain how a creditor has filed a civil suit against you and how you need to call a 1 877 number to pay a settlement amount to avoid going to court. They also explain that you will be served with court papers at home or at work (a dumb premise, I will explain later). I knew it was fake, so I called the local number back instead of the 1 877 number.  They answered as the fake law office.
